GuardApp-个人提醒工具,预算25K以内
8小时前
项目介绍
项目名称(代号):GuardApp-个人提醒工具
项目概述
开发一款安卓端的个人提醒工具,支持用户创建多条提醒内容,并具备两种触发条件:
1.用户可设定未来时间触发。
2.系统可基于用户设定的时间间隔自动触发(需配合用户行为状态判断)。
核心功能模块(技术视角)
·内容管理
·用户可创建多个“内容单元”,每个单元包含:标题、正文、接收人信息(姓名+手机号或邮箱)。
·支持增删改查,并支持开关(是否纳入自动触发名单)。
·后端需校验用户的总数量限制(不同等级数量不同)。
·定时任务
·用户可为某个内容单元设定未来的执行时间(精确到日)。
·后台每分钟扫描到期任务,调用短信/邮件接口发送。
·状态检测与自动触发
·用户需定期通过推送点击进行状态确认(前端集成推送,点击后上报时间戳)。
·后端需实现一个定时扫描(每30分钟),检查用户最后上报时间是否超过预设阈值(如24h)。
·若超过且用户未开启“临时豁免”标志,则自动发送该用户所有被标记为“允许自动触发”的内容单元。
·每次自动触发需消耗用户的一种“点数”,点数用尽则不再触发。
·临时豁免
·用户可设置一个时间段,期间暂停所有自动触发检测(不消耗点数)。
·测试模拟
·提供一个后端接口,用户可触发一次模拟的自动触发流程(发送内容标记为测试)。每个用户终身仅一次。
·内购
·集成自动续期订阅和消耗型内购,用于解锁更多内容数量、更多定时/自动触发点数。
技术栈要求
·前端:Flutter或FlutterFlow(输出iOS)
·后端:Supabase+Node.js云函数
·推送:OneSignal
·短信/邮件:阿里云/腾讯云SMS+SendGrid
预算与周期
预算1.5-2.5万,工期4-6周。
交付物
源码、后端部署文档、数据库脚本、内购配置清单。
对开发者要求
有Flutter/Supabase/云函数/内购经验,提供案例。
备注
·所有知识产权归甲方。
·合作前需签署保密协议(见附件),签署后提供完整产品需求文档。
项目名称(代号):GuardApp-个人提醒工具
项目概述
开发一款安卓端的个人提醒工具,支持用户创建多条提醒内容,并具备两种触发条件:
1.用户可设定未来时间触发。
2.系统可基于用户设定的时间间隔自动触发(需配合用户行为状态判断)。
核心功能模块(技术视角)
·内容管理
·用户可创建多个“内容单元”,每个单元包含:标题、正文、接收人信息(姓名+手机号或邮箱)。
·支持增删改查,并支持开关(是否纳入自动触发名单)。
·后端需校验用户的总数量限制(不同等级数量不同)。
·定时任务
·用户可为某个内容单元设定未来的执行时间(精确到日)。
·后台每分钟扫描到期任务,调用短信/邮件接口发送。
·状态检测与自动触发
·用户需定期通过推送点击进行状态确认(前端集成推送,点击后上报时间戳)。
·后端需实现一个定时扫描(每30分钟),检查用户最后上报时间是否超过预设阈值(如24h)。
·若超过且用户未开启“临时豁免”标志,则自动发送该用户所有被标记为“允许自动触发”的内容单元。
·每次自动触发需消耗用户的一种“点数”,点数用尽则不再触发。
·临时豁免
·用户可设置一个时间段,期间暂停所有自动触发检测(不消耗点数)。
·测试模拟
·提供一个后端接口,用户可触发一次模拟的自动触发流程(发送内容标记为测试)。每个用户终身仅一次。
·内购
·集成自动续期订阅和消耗型内购,用于解锁更多内容数量、更多定时/自动触发点数。
技术栈要求
·前端:Flutter或FlutterFlow(输出iOS)
·后端:Supabase+Node.js云函数
·推送:OneSignal
·短信/邮件:阿里云/腾讯云SMS+SendGrid
预算与周期
预算1.5-2.5万,工期4-6周。
交付物
源码、后端部署文档、数据库脚本、内购配置清单。
对开发者要求
有Flutter/Supabase/云函数/内购经验,提供案例。
备注
·所有知识产权归甲方。
·合作前需签署保密协议(见附件),签署后提供完整产品需求文档。
*************
*************
评论
